Relativistic multiconfiguration Dirac-Fock calculation of energy levels and oscillator strengths in a Fe XVII ion
All energy levels of the 2p53s, 3p and 3d configurations and electrio dipole oscillator strengths f values of 3s-3p, 3p-3d transitions in a neon-like ion Fe XVII have been calculated by means of the relativistio multiconfiguration Dirac-Fock (MCDF) approximate method. Calculated energy levels show a good agreement with the observations, and the MODF approximation are well suited for the calculations of energy levels in the neon-like isoeleotronio sequence. The oscillator strengths given in this paper are only theoretically prophetical values, thus far experimental values are unknown.
